Terrain Clearing in Katy, TX
Terrain clearing services involve removing trees, brush, rocks, and other obstructions to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or other development projects. These services typically cover tasks such as stump removal, brush chipping, grading, and debris hauling to create a clean, level, and accessible site. Property owners often request terrain clearing when planning to build a new structure, install a driveway, or improve outdoor spaces, ensuring the land is suitable for future use.
Before requesting terrain clearing,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the size of the area to be cleared and any specific features that need to be preserved or removed. It’s also helpful to understand local regulations regarding tree removal or land alteration, as well as any potential permits required. Clarifying these details can help ensure the work aligns with project goals and property requirements.

Common Terrain Clearing Jobs
Brush removal - clearing overgrown brush to improve yard appearance and access.
Tree and shrub clearing - removing unwanted trees and shrubs to prepare for construction or landscaping.
Lot clearing - removing debris, rocks, and vegetation to create a level building site.
Fence line clearing - trimming or removing vegetation along property boundaries for fencing projects.
Storm debris removal - clearing fallen branches and debris after severe weather events.
Underbrush clearing - thinning dense undergrowth to reduce fire risk and enhance property safety.
Terrain Clearing Questions
What types of terrain can be cleared? Terrain clearing services can handle various landscapes, including wooded areas, overgrown fields, and uneven ground to prepare properties for development or landscaping.
Is terrain clearing suitable for large properties? Yes, terrain clearing is effective for both small and large properties, helping to remove obstacles and create level areas for future use.
What equipment is used for terrain cl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and skid steers are commonly used to efficiently remove trees, stumps, and debris.
What should property owners consider before terrain clearing? It's important to evaluate the type of vegetation, soil condition, and any local regulations related to land modification before starting the project.
